THE problem of the minibus " pirate " was referred to by Mr. R. J. Ellery, chairman of the Trent Motor Traction Co., Ltd., at the company's annual meeting on Wednesday. "They are appearing on the roads in our area in increasing numbers," he said, "and I make no bones about saying that many of them are still being operated illegally."

Mr. Ellery said he was glad the Traffic Commissioners were doing all they could to deal with the situation and in future it would not be possible for minibus operators to plead ignorance of the law,
